Paul Marinoni
Paul Marinoni passed away peacefully at his ‘mansion’ in Susanville on May 12, 2021, at the age of 57. He was born in Susanville on Dec. 23, 1963, to Achille ‘Nini’ and Jean Marinoni.
Paul attended McKinley, Diamond View, and Richmond School. He graduated from Lassen High School and Lassen Community College and attended the University of California, Davis.
He worked in construction, including helping his dad build the family apartments. He always looked forward to annual hunting, fishing, and camping trips with his brother and nephews, Dustin and Trenton Morgan. He also enjoyed snowmobiling and motorcycling.
Paul spent most of his time at the family cabin at Eagle Lake where he was watermaster for Eagle Nest Homeowners Association and always kept a careful eye on cabins when owners were not around.
Paul had a passion for brewing great beer and enjoyed sharing his homebrews with friends. You would often find him on the lake in his dad’s handmade 1959 boat giving boat rides and teaching people how to waterski. Paul also loved vacationing with family and enjoyed many hours by the pool and in the hot tub. In recent years, Paul spent time with family in Reno playing slots and enjoying cocktails. Paul was a very considerate person and was always holding the door for everyone.
His friendly nature allowed for conversations with many people no matter where he went. He was preceeded in death by his father in 2013. He is survived by his mother Jean Marinoni; brother Dino Marinoni; sisters Janet Marinoni and Julie Morgan.
